Transaction 0153fb366312f4558d238f59eb234d9a5b84532ab4951db2ed4e33352deec3e6

1 Input
1 Outputs
  • 0153fb366312f4558d238f59eb234d9a5b84532ab4951db2ed4e33352deec3e6:0
  • value  658886
    address  19PyUyrYbZyKwxJ3HEnjHiy6bs9D24gror